Review of the 10FT Adjustable Pickleball/Badminton Net

As an avid pickleball player, I’m always on the lookout for versatile gear that enhances my playing experience, especially when space is limited. I recently got my hands on the 10FT Adjustable Net, which claims to be perfect for indoor and outdoor use, accommodating various sports from pickleball to badminton. Given my busy schedule and the need for a portable solution, I had high hopes for this product.

Product Image

Upon unpacking the net, I was immediately impressed by its construction. The nylon mesh feels robust, and the poles are both lightweight and sturdy, made of rust-resistant coated steel that’s notably thicker than many competitors. This durability was a significant factor for me, as I wanted something that could withstand both indoor games and varying weather conditions when used outside.

Setting up the net was a breeze. In under five minutes, I had it ready to use—no tools or stakes required, just as promised! The bungee-connected frame makes assembly intuitive, and I appreciated the fact that there are no loose parts to misplace. From my experience, the height adjustments (ranging from 34” to 60”) allow for great versatility. I was able to customize it based on the type of game we were playing, from casual pickleball matches to more intense badminton sessions.

One of my favorite aspects highlighted by other users, including Collin M., was the net’s portability. It packs down easily into a complementary carry bag that is spacious yet compact enough to throw in the trunk of my car for impromptu matches at the park. I found this incredibly useful, as I often head to different courts and appreciate a net that can easily follow wherever I go.

However, it hasn’t been all smooth sailing. A downside I’d like to mention is that, occasionally, the net droops slightly after extended use, which Garrett Waltz from the reviews also noted. It’s not a deal-breaker, but it does require you to occasionally readjust it, especially during competitive games. Additionally, the poles don’t come with rubber caps at the edges, which makes sliding the net onto them a bit tricky and could risk tearing the mesh if not done carefully, as one reviewer pointed out.
